在pythong中,除了用threading来实现多线程外,还可以通过继承Thread,重写run方法来实现一个自定义的类。
下面介绍第二种方式:从Thread继承,然后重写run方法:
例子程序如下:
功能:创建两个线程,一个用继承Thread方式,一个用threading来实现。
代码如下:
#!/usr/bin/python
# -*- coding: utf-8 -*-
#文件:test_threadclass.py
import threading
import time
#自定义类
class MyThread(threading.Thread):
def __init__(self):
threading.Thread.__init__(self);
def run(self):
for i in range(5):
print("MyThread: =====i:",str(i));
time.sleep(1);
# time.sleep(random.randrange(0,2));
#功能:求data中的数据的和,data是一个list。
def sum(data):
print("sum data===begin==");
sum_res = 0;
print("input data of sum:");
for i in range(len(data)):
time.sleep(1); #延时1s
print('data in sum_res',data[i]);
sum_res = sum_res + (int)(data[i]); #求和,注意需要用int进行数字字符的转换
print("input data of sum_res:",sum_res);
return sum_res;
#test
def test_func():
d1_list=[];
i = 0;
while i<10:
d1_list.append(i);
i= i + 1;
#创建thread
sum_thread = threading.Thread(target=sum,args=(d1_list,));
mMyThread = MyThread();
#启动线程
sum_thread.start();
mMyThread.start();
#main
if __name__ == '__main__':
test_func();
